Output 63bf4248816287cacf43d6fc49417292fccc3e4167e73f9de21dcd2d43011481:4

value
713305
script pubkey
OP_0 OP_PUSHBYTES_32 dde16f8fcb675c74cb7531cf053ca37cb69c13b960976c21b90bae61bfef392e
address
bc1qmhsklr7tvaw8fjm4x88s209r0jmfcyaevztkcgdepwhxr0l08yhqv8pl8f
transaction
63bf4248816287cacf43d6fc49417292fccc3e4167e73f9de21dcd2d43011481
spent
true